Sanguimancy, Sorcery, designed by Dave Kendall first released in May, 2020 in the set Born of the Gods.
A deck focused on black devotion in Magic: the Gathering would benefit most from using Sanguimancy, as it allows for card draw and life loss based on the amount of black mana symbols in play. However, a better alternative could be the card Necropotence, which also provides card advantage at the cost of life without being dependent on devotion. Sanguimancy could see play in specific black devotion decks looking for additional card draw options, but its effectiveness may vary depending on the overall strategy and synergy of the deck.

Hybrid mana symbols, monocolored hybrid mana symbols, and Phyrexian mana symbols do count toward your devotion to their color(s).

Numeric mana symbols (, , and so on) in mana costs of permanents you control don’t count toward your devotion to any color.
